Abstract

A display device is provided including a display region arranged with a plurality of pixels, and a first sealing region arranged in an exterior periphery part of the display region, the display region includes an individual pixel electrode arranged in each of the plurality of pixels, a common pixel electrode arranged in upper layer of the individual pixel electrode and in succession to the plurality of pixels, and a light emitting layer arranged between the individual pixel electrode and the common pixel electrode, and the first sealing region includes a sealing layer arranged on a lower layer than the common pixel electrode and a region stacked with the common pixel electrode extending from the display region, the stacked region being enclosed by the display region.

Claims (39)

1. A display device comprising:

a display region arranged with a plurality of pixels;

a first sealing region arranged in an exterior periphery part of the display region; and

a bank arranged so as to enclose the display region,

wherein:

the display region includes an individual pixel electrode arranged in each of the plurality of pixels, a common pixel electrode over the individual pixel electrode and in succession to the plurality of pixels, and a light emitting layer arranged between the individual pixel electrode and the common pixel electrode;

the first sealing region includes a sealing layer arranged on a lower layer than the common pixel electrode and a region stacked with the common pixel electrode extending from the display region, the stacked region enclosing the display region;

an end of the light emitting layer and the bank are separated from each other;

the bank is arranged so as to cover an end part of the sealing layer; and

the common pixel electrode and the sealing layer cover the end of the light emitting layer.

2. The display device according to claim 1 , wherein the light emitting layer is arranged extending to the first sealing region and overlaps a part of the sealing layer in the exterior periphery part.

3. The display device according to claim 2 , wherein the sealing layer is formed from a conductive material.

4. The display device according to claim 3 , wherein the sealing layer includes the same layer structure as the individual pixel electrode.

5. The display device according to claim 4 further comprising:

a low voltage power source wire,

wherein the sealing layer is conductive with the low voltage power source wire.

6. The display device according to claim 5 further comprising:

an insulation layer arranged below the individual pixel electrode; and

an auxiliary electrode arranged below the insulation layer.

7. The display device according to claim 6 , wherein the common pixel electrode contacts the auxiliary electrode and a region contacting the auxiliary electrode encloses the first sealing region.

8. The display device according to claim 7 further comprising:

a second sealing region enclosing the first sealing region.

9. The display device according to claim 1 , wherein the light emitting layer includes a common light emitting layer arranged in common with the plurality of pixels.

10. The display device according to claim 1 further comprising:

an individual light emitting layer arranged for each pixel, the individual light emitting layer being one of a red light emitting layer, green light emitting layer, blue light emitting layer, and white light emitting layer.

11. The display device according to claim 1 , wherein the bank is arranged so as to cover an end part of the sealing layer.

12. The display device according to claim 1 further comprising:

a substrate,

wherein the sealing layer is arranged between the substrate and the common pixel electrode.

13. The display device according to claim 1 further comprising:

a filler,

wherein the sealing layer overlaps the filler.

14. The display device according to claim 1 , wherein the stacked region includes a region where the sealing layer and the common pixel electrode contact with each other, the contact region enclosing the display region.

15. The display device according to claim 1 , wherein an end of the light emitting layer is arranged in the stacked region.

16. The display device according to claim 1 , wherein the light emitting layer contacts with the common electrode in the stacked region.

17. The display device according to claim 2 , wherein the light emitting layer contacts with a part of the sealing layer.

18. The display device according to claim 1 , wherein an end part of the light emitting layer extends within a region of 20 μm or more and 250 μm or less to the exterior side of the display region from a pixel arranged on the outermost periphery among the plurality of pixels.

19. The display device according to claim 1 , wherein the sealing layer includes an inorganic material.

20. The display device according to claim 1 , wherein the bank and the sealing layer partially overlap with each other.
